Загрузка...

NumPy EP5 Part 2: argpartition vs argsort | หา Nearest Neighbors เร็วขึ้นแบบมือโปร

ใน EP5 Part 2 นี้ เราจะพาไปต่อจาก Fancy Indexing และ k-Nearest Neighbors (kNN)
โดยโฟกัสที่ “การทำให้เร็วขึ้น” ด้วย NumPy

หลายคนใช้ np.argsort() เพื่อหา nearest neighbors
ซึ่งให้ผลลัพธ์ถูกต้องและเรียงลำดับครบ

แต่ในงานจริง โดยเฉพาะข้อมูลขนาดใหญ่
เราไม่จำเป็นต้อง sort ทั้งหมด!

คลิปนี้จะพาเข้าใจ:
- np.argpartition คืออะไร?
- ต่างจาก argsort ยังไง?
- ทำไม argpartition ถึงเร็วกว่า?
- เทคนิคเลือก k neighbors แบบไม่ต้อง sort ทั้ง array
- วิธีจัดการกรณีที่ "ตัวเอง" ติดเข้ามาในผลลัพธ์

พร้อมตัวอย่าง kNN แบบ NumPy ล้วน ที่สามารถนำไปใช้ต่อยอดได้จริง
เช่น Data Science, Machine Learning, และระบบ IoT/AI

📌 เหมาะสำหรับ:
- คนที่เริ่มเรียน NumPy / Data Science
- Dev ที่อยาก optimize performance
- สาย AI / ML ที่ทำงานกับข้อมูลขนาดใหญ่

---

📦 Source Code:
https://github.com/KOPE-SOLUTION/numpy-for-data-engineering

---

#NumPy #DataScience #MachineLearning #kNN #Python #AI #Optimization #Broadcasting #argpartition #argsort

Видео NumPy EP5 Part 2: argpartition vs argsort | หา Nearest Neighbors เร็วขึ้นแบบมือโปร канала KOPE SOLUTION
Яндекс.Метрика
Все заметки Новая заметка Страницу в заметки
Страницу в закладки Мои закладки
На информационно-развлекательном портале SALDA.WS применяются cookie-файлы. Нажимая кнопку Принять, вы подтверждаете свое согласие на их использование.
О CookiesНапомнить позжеПринять